The Audi A5 can be had in both coupe and Sportback body styles. Customers can also opt for a cabriolet, however, that is an S5 and in this article, we will be focussing on the A5 range, more specifically the coupe variant. Here are the top three Audi A5 trims head-to-head.
The latest iterations of the Audi A5 range arrived locally towards the end of 2020. The coupe model is made available in three trim levels, however, a more powerful S5 coupe, that was revealed at the same time, is also on offer from the German automaker. As per Audi's model naming conventions, all three of the current A5 coupe derivates fall within a similar power range and as such bare the 40 monikers on the rear.
The model, however, is offered in combinations of rear-wheel driven and all-wheel-drive variants with both petrol and diesel engines available. Let us take a closer look at how the three trim levels compare.
Exterior
The Audi A5 is offered in either the standard specification or S line guise. The standard specification incorporates 15-spoke alloy wheels in 17-inch size while the door sills feature finished with aluminium inlays. Upfront the grille is finished in matte black with a contrasting chrome frame garnish. Similar to the grille, the side air inlets as well as the rear diffuser comes in a grained matte black.
Contrasting the darker elements is matte aluminium tailpipe tips as well as a tailgate trim piece finished in chrome. The S line trim level receives upgrades such as 18-inch, 5-twin-spoke design alloy wheels. The door sills also come with an illuminated S logo while the same logo also features on the front fenders.
Below the door sills are wider body-coloured side skirting while upfront the matte black S line-specific grille sees the addition of an S line emblem. The matte black rear diffuser also changes shape to an S line-specific model and is complemented by the flanking tailpipe pieces in a matte aluminium silver finish. The grained matte black side air inlets are also bolstered with silver-grey inlays. One of the main benefits of the S line trim level is the sports suspension that features as standard equipment.
Interior
Like with the exterior, the interior configuration also see upgrades fitted once the S line is selected. In place of the standard leather seats, customers of the S line models can expect sport seats for the front occupants and are optionally available in Nappa leather. The lighter headlining is replaced with black material to match the accent surfaces now painted in gloss black.
Other decorative inserts on the interior get a matte brushed aluminium surface while in the driver footwell, stainless steel pedals and footrest feature. S line logos also feature around the cabin such as on the steering wheel. Customers are able to choose from the optional Technology, Sports and Comfort packages available for the model to further bolster the interior features.
Engine and drivetrain
As alluded to earlier, all three derivatives fall within a similar power range, however, come offer rear-wheel-drive while the flagship A5 offering comes fitted with Audi's quattro system powering all four wheels. Let us compare the models side by side to see the configurations.
| Audi A5 coupe 40TFSI | Audi A5 coupe 40TFSI S line | Audi A5 coupe 40TDI quattro S line | |
| Engine | 2.0-litre, turbocharged, 4-cylinder petrol | 2.0-litre, turbocharged, 4-cylinder petrol | 2.0-litre, turbocharged, 4-cylinder diesel |
| Transmission | 7-speed automated dual-clutch | 7-speed automated dual-clutch | 7-speed automated dual-clutch |
| Driven wheels | Rear | Rear | Four-wheel-drive |
| Power | 140 kW | 140 kW | 140 kW |
| Torque | 320 Nm | 320 Nm | 400 Nm |
| 0-100 km/h | 7.3s | 7.3s | 7.4s |
| Top speed | 241 km/h | 241 km/h | 235 km/h |
| Fuel consumption | 6.4 L / 100 km | 6.4 L / 100 km | 6.0 L / 100 km |
| CO2 emission | 145 g/km | 145 g/km | 158 g/km |
*This table was compiled with information sourced from www.duoporta.co.za
Conclusion
At the time of writing this article, there is an R 45 000 price difference between the Audi A5 coupe 40TFSI and the Audi A5 coupe 40TFSI S line. The jump in price between the latter model and the diesel-powered Audi A5 coupe 40TDI quattro S line is R 43 500. Taking into consideration that all three models offer similar power levels, the main benefit of choosing the Audi A5 coupe 40TDI quattro S line is the all-wheel-drive system.
If you are planning to push the vehicle to its limits, the quattro system will provide the much-needed grip in the corners and will be worth the additional spend. However, if you are merely going to commute with the A5 and/or take the occasional leisurely drive on the weekends the Audi A5 coupe 40TFSI S line will be more than competent and as such is our winner between the three. We would rather use the R 43 500 on the additional packages available such as the Technology package.
